Abstract
The aim of the study was to evaluate changes in the central visual pathways during the early and advanced stages of bilateral normal-tension glaucoma (NTG).Entities:
Keywords: MRI; NTG; cortical thickness; glaucoma; lateral geniculate nucleus

Demographic and clinical characteristics of the studied groups.
| Control Group | Early Glaucoma | Advanced Glaucoma | |
|---|---|---|---|
| Age | 68.5 ± 11.8 | 63.2 ± 11.4 | 65 ± 14.7 |
| Male/female | 4/13 | 8/20 | 5/11 |
| Mean visual field MD (dB)—right eye | - | −2.97 (from −5.88 to −0.11) | −19.45 (form −29.53 to −16.18) |
| Mean visual field MD (dB)—left eye | - | −3.96 (from −5.93 to −0.43) | −18.33 (form −25.48 to −14.1) |
